The present invention relates to a stacked cell comprising: a power generation element formed of a plurality of single cell layers connected in series and stacked, each single cell layer comprising a positive electrode collector, a positive electrode active material layer, an electrolyte layer, a negative electrode active material layer, and a negative electrode collector stacked in order; and an exterior body, in which the power generation element is disposed, wherein the positive electrode collector and/or the negative electrode collector comprises a conductive resin layer, and the power generation element is further equipped with a resistance reducing layer that is next to the resin layer and on the outer surface side of the single cell layer comprising the resin layer. The present invention provides a means to increase the output performance of a stacked secondary cell using a resin collector. |
